NAND and NOR flash memory both have different architecture and used for specific purpose. Types of Flash Memoryįlash memory is available in two kinds NAND Flash and NOR Flash Memory. In hard-disk, disk rotation takes time to move on the particular cylinder, track or sector.However,in a flash, no rotating time disc has created a barrier for fast access. Flash memory gives faster access to data content as compared to hard disk. Flash memory was used in many devices like in form SD card, Pen-drive (moveable storage), camera card and video card, and so forth. However, flash memory does not require the power for holding data. Flash memory is different from RAM.RAM is volatile memory, needs electricity and power to maintain its content. Flash memory is an electronic chip that retains its stored data without any power. ![]()
